Victor Leo Gordon BOYLE

Regimental number4559
Place of birthFitzroy, Victoria
ReligionChurch of England
OccupationBricklayer
AddressPO, Beenup, Western Australia
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ation18.1
Height5' 4.25"
Weight126 lbs
Next of kinBrother, P T Boyle on Active Service and R Boyle, Beenup, Western Australia
Previous military serviceNil (Exempt Area under Compulsory Military Training scheme)
Enlistment date10 November 1915
Date of enlistment from Nominal Roll8 November 1915
Place of enlistmentPerth, Western Australia
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name16th Battalion, 14th Reinforcement
AWM Embarkation Roll number23/33/3
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Fremantle, Western Australia, on board HMAT A28 Miltiades on 12 February 1916
Rank from Nominal RollPrivate
Unit from Nominal Roll48th Battalion
FateReturned to Australia 3 March 1919
Miscellaneous information from
  cemetery records
Plaque in Western Australia Garden of Remembrance
Discharge date18 September 1919
Other details

War service: Egypt, Western Front

Reported missing in action, 5 April 1918; subsequently reported prisoner of war in Germany.

Repatriated from Germany; arrived England, 12 January 1919.

Commenced return to Australia on board HT 'Euripides', 3 March 1919; discharged (medically unfit), Perth, 18 September 1919.

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al
Date of death23 December 1966
Age at death69
Place of burialKarrakatta Cemetery and Crematorium, Perth, Western Australia
